Output efbd6e3015d3c7784f53420ef979fb30fd988afa98b9df80181ff36851731b2f:9

value
14348907
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 56fc7b1451ce20e0670e97b1a9cdcf34c0e118e9ee9fcfcec3bd80fcaf6ed70a
address
bc1p2m78k9z3ecswqecwj7c6nnw0xnqwzx8fa60ulnkrhkq0etmw6u9q8aguu6
transaction
efbd6e3015d3c7784f53420ef979fb30fd988afa98b9df80181ff36851731b2f